Tall Tall Trees
Banjo Magic, Baby

Now, let’s talk about Tall Tall Trees—the ones who strum banjos like they’re casting spells. Here’s the scoop:

Banjo Wizard: Meet Mike Savino, the banjo slinger. But he’s not your grandpa’s banjo player either. He’s a one-man psychedelic indie-folk orchestra. His secret weapon? The Banjotron 5000 (yeah, he built it himself). Imagine a banjo on steroids, plugged into a slab of effects pedals, and loopers. It’s like banjo meets the Matrix.

Sound: Banjo notes that ripple through time, bluegrass vibes with a side of mind-bending. Think Rogue Wave jamming with the spirit of Johnny Appleseed.

Legend: Savino’s banjo has touched South American soil, danced with Kishi Bashi, and whispered secrets to the Appalachian mountains. His album Freedays? Pure forest magic.
